WordPress security by component
WP Testimonials
Plugin description
WP Testimonials is a WordPress component with 2 published CVE records in this archive. The latest tracked vulnerability was published Mar 28, 2024; the highest CVE/CNA score is 7.6.

CVE-2024-25924: WP Testimonials: SQL injection
WP Testimonials is affected by SQL injection. Exposure depends on how the affected operation is made reachable by the site. A successful request can alter database queries and expose or modify WordPress data.

CVE-2023-2830
Testimonial Widgets: Cross-site request forgery
Testimonial Widgets is affected by cross-site request forgery. Exposure depends on how the affected operation is made reachable by the site. Exploitation relies on a signed-in privileged user submitting an attacker-controlled request.
